Oracle create table as select without data

WebCREATE TABLE users_ny_alt (id PRIMARY KEY FAMILY ids, name, city FAMILY locs, address, credit_card FAMILY payments) AS SELECT id, name, city, address, credit_card FROM users WHERE city = 'new york'; SELECT * FROM users_ny_alt; WebDec 4, 2024 · oracle create table as select A table can be created from an existing table in the database using a sub query option. The table is created with specified column names …

Create table as select.... with partitions - Oracle Forums

http://www.rebellionrider.com/copy-table-with-or-without-data-using-create-table-as-statement/ WebApr 30, 2011 · GO ----Create a new table and insert into table using SELECT, INSERT SELECT FirstName, LastName INTO TestTable FROM Person.Contact WHERE EmailPromotion = 2 ----Verify that Data in TestTable SELECT FirstName, LastName FROM TestTable ----Clean Up Database DROP TABLE TestTable GO This is a very popular method. czech republic invasion https://bear4homes.com

SQL CREATE TABLE Syntax and Examples - Database Star

WebIn a multi-table index cluster, related table rows are grouped together to reduce disk I/O. For example, assume that you have a customer and orders table and 95% of the access is to select all orders for a particular customer. Oracle will have to perform an I/O to fetch the customer row and then multiple I/Os to fetch each order for the customer. WebApr 12, 2024 · Here, the WHERE clause is used to filter out a select list containing the ‘FirstName’, ‘LastName’, ‘Phone’, and ‘CompanyName’ columns from the rows that contain the value ‘Sharp ... WebFeb 23, 2024 · To see how to create a table from another table in Oracle, look at the below script: CREATE TABLE table_name AS ( SELECT select_query ); It’s also referred to as … binghamton sun press bulletin

Oracle / PLSQL: CREATE TABLE AS Statement

Category:Oracle / PLSQL: CREATE TABLE AS Statement

Tags:Oracle create table as select without data

Oracle create table as select without data

Can we do a CTAS (Create table as) without the NOT ... - Oracle …

WebSo before adding the NOT NULL constraint, you need to make sure that the existing data in the surcharges table does not violate the NOT NULL constraint: UPDATE surcharges SET amount = 0 WHERE amount IS NULL ; Code language: SQL (Structured Query Language) (sql) Now, if you execute the ALTER TABLE statement again: WebUsing sql developer select the table and click on the DDL tab. You can use that code to create a new table with no data when you run it in a sql worksheet. sqldeveloper is a free to use app from oracle. If the table has sequences or triggers the ddl will sometimes generate those for you too.

Oracle create table as select without data

Did you know?

WebNov 20, 2009 · i wanted to ask if it's possible to create a table as select from, specyfing also a partition schema, or if it's possible to add to this table the partitions later. This table is very very big, so i can't use the INSERT statement (it take 16 hours when create table as takes 30 minutes) Any suggestion will be appreciated! Thanks in advance http://www.rebellionrider.com/copy-table-with-or-without-data-using-create-table-as-statement/

WebAug 18, 2024 · CREATE TABLE new_table AS (SELECT *) FROM old_table WHERE 1=0); For example: CREATE TABLE suppliers AS (SELECT *) FROM companies WHERE 1=0); This will create a new table with the name suppliers, which includes all columns from the companies table, but without any data from the companies table. WebAS SELECT statement is determined by one of the following rules: The query part uses the values specified in the PARALLEL clause of the CREATE part. If the PARALLEL clause is …

WebOct 15, 2024 · You can also create a table based on a select statement. This makes a table with the same columns and rows as the source query. This operation is known as create-table-as-select (CTAS). This is a handy way to copy one table to another. For example, the following creates toys_clone from toys: Copy code snippet WebDec 22, 2024 · Using Oracle create table with As Select statement we can copy or duplicate the table columns and rows in oracle database 19c. Mention the name of schema with table name if you copying it from other table of different user. Syntax: In the below code, we have used the ‘As Select’ statement to create a table from another table.

http://www.dba-oracle.com/oracle_tip_hash_index_cluster_table.htm

WebWhen you specify the AS SELECT clause to create a table and populate it with data from another table, you can utilize parallel execution. The CREATE TABLE...AS SELECT statement contains two parts: a CREATE part (DDL) and a SELECT part (query). Oracle Database can parallelize both parts of the statement. binghamton sweatshirtWebJul 5, 2016 · SELECT 'CREATE TABLE ' table_name '_bkup AS SELECT * FROM ' table_name ';' FROM user_tables; Now the query that would be generated would be something like - CREATE TABLE a_bkup AS SELECT * FROM a; Within the statement above is there any Oracle keyword with which it is ensured that none of the tables have NOT … czech republic in chineseWebSep 20, 2024 · Alternatively, you can create your table like normal, without the AS SELECT, and use an INSERT INTO SELECT to populate the records into the table. CREATE TABLE … czech republic in hindiWebTo create a new table in Oracle Database, you use the CREATE TABLE statement. The following illustrates the basic syntax of the CREATE TABLE statement: CREATE TABLE schema_name.table_name ( column_1 data_type column_constraint, column_2 data_type column_constraint, ... table_constraint ); Code language: SQL (Structured Query … czech republic in germanWebTables are created with no data unless a subquery is specified. You can add rows to a table with the INSERT statement. After creating a table, you can define additional columns, partitions, and integrity constraints with the ADD clause of the ALTER TABLE statement. czech republic horses for saleWebCREATE TABLE new_table AS (SELECT * FROM old_table WHERE 1=2); For example: CREATE TABLE suppliers AS (SELECT * FROM companies WHERE 1=2); This would … czech republic independence date yearWebJan 30, 2024 · Awgiedawgie. -- Copy a table (datas, columns and storage parameters) CREATE TABLE my_new_table AS SELECT * FROM my_source_table; -- Use NOLOGGING, … czech republic interest rates